2nd annual Chili Cook-off & Vendor Fair scheduled for Sept. 21

Greater T.R. Chamber Chili Cook-off

 The second annual Greater Travelers Rest Chamber of Commerce Chili Cook-off and Vendor Fair is scheduled for Saturday, Sept. 21, 2013, at Trailblazer Park, the future Travelers Rest cultural and performing arts center located on Wilhelm Winter Street.

Travelers Rest named 2013 Urban Conservationist of the Year

Travelers Rest named 2013 Urban Conservationist of the YearThe city of Travelers Rest was named the 2013 Urban Conservationist of the Year by the Greenville County Soil and Water Conservation District.

According to Conservation District Chairman Robert Hanley, Travelers Rest received the recognition for its development of a pedestrian-friendly downtown, dedication to litter prevention programs and support of the GHS Swamp Rabbit Trail as well as the transformation of Buncombe Road Park and encouragement of "numerous outdoor recreation opportunities”.

Travelers Rest votes to annex Furman University into city

At its regularly scheduled meeting Thursday night, Travelers Rest City Council unanimously approved an ordinance to annex Furman University and Furman Foundation properties into its city limits.

Multiple properties – including the university campus, the golf course, the Vinings at Duncan Chapel apartments and the Woodlands at Furman retirement community are included in the annexation.

The annexation will increase the size of Travelers Rest by over 900 acres, about one-third of its current size.

Travelers Rest 'paints the town purple'

Travelers Rest business owners and municipal employees have been busy “painting the town purple” to help raise awareness for the Travelers Rest Area Relay For Life, an annual American Cancer Society (ACS) fundraising event. 

Buildings and lampposts throughout town are decorated with all things purple – purple ribbon, purple bows, purple signs, purple flowers, and purple wreaths, to name a few – in support of the campaign.

The relay, during which teams camp out overnight and take turns walking the track, is scheduled to take place at the site of the former Travelers Rest High School on Wilhelm Winter Street in Travelers Rest on Friday, April 26 beginning at 7 p.m.

Travelers Rest Artists Alliance seeks members

The Travelers Rest Artists Alliance is seeking member artists in a variety of disciplines – including visual, literary, performing and culinary arts – to join the newly-formed organization. 

The Alliance plans to sponsor art festivals, concerts and recitals, theater and music workshops, literary performances and performing arts shows, among other things. The group also plans to conduct art classes, theater and music workshops, mentoring programs and various lectures.
